Abstract
The phenomenon of Internet has brought a wide range of communication possibilities and thus a rapid growth of digitized information. Each day the user is overwhelmed with the vast information obtained during the search process, which can hardly identify those that have greater relevance to their information need With the aim of facing this problem, an authoring tool of adaptive hypermedia system, oriented toward the personalization of readings plans in a learning environment, was developed with a view to assessing its effectiveness and the user's satisfaction vis-à-vis the proposed adaptation algorithm. This application is based on clustering algorithms and adaptation rules to adjust the user's model to contents and objects of study. Research is conducted according to the action-research methodology. The system was accepted by 89.5% of the sample assessment using the Technology Acceptance Model TAM.
